What are the effects of oseltamivir phosphate granules?

Oseltamivir Phosphate Granules works by blocking viral invasion into cells, with the aim of preventing viral replication and release. The main ingredient of Oseltamivir Phosphate Granules is Oseltamivir Phosphate, which belongs to an antiviral class of neuraminidase inhibitors. Neuraminidase is a glycoprotein enzyme on the surface of viruses, and its activity can play a role in inhibiting and preventing the spread of newly formed viruses. Clinically, it can be used to treat influenza A and influenza B in adults and children over one year of age.
